While at the Hero Con this weekend, I discovered a great little graphic novel series called Owly by Andy Runton. I want to do a totally unsolicited pitch for this comic. I passed his table at publisher Top Shelf during the convention and was drawn to the images of the cute little owl with the big eyes. Being jaded as I am, I half expected it to be one of those “cute” comics that lure you into a sense of security right before something horrible happens, AKA Adult Swim. So I checked out his website right before the last day at the ‘con and was delighted to find that Owly is exactly what it seems to be, an adorable, safe-for-all-ages story about a cute li’l owl and his friends! I went back to his table the next day and bought two books which he signed with a little sketch to my son and my niece. I wish I had ponied up the $20 for a custom sketch of Owly as a fencer! Well, maybe I’ll see him at the next ‘con and I won’t be so cheap. So if you like cute, or you want to introduce your kids to safe, nonviolent comics, check out Owly!
